Common Situations That Require Immediate Electrical Help

Some electrical issues can wait, but others can’t. Quick-response local-electricians in town are your go-to for:

  • Power outages affecting specific areas of the house
  • Burning smells from panels or outlets
  • Exposed wiring after remodels or accidents
  • Breaker tripping repeatedly
  • Storm-related damage

How Technology Helps Speed Up Response Times

Today’s electricians are more connected than ever. Scheduling, dispatching, and diagnostics have all seen tech upgrades recently. Dispatch software can locate and route technicians more efficiently. Similarly, some electricians use remote diagnostics, which means they may begin solving your issue even before arriving on-site.

One of our partners uses smart inspection tools, including thermal imaging, to detect hot spots behind walls. This reduces the guesswork and saves valuable time. As a result, not only is the response fast, but the solution is precise.

When DIY Isn’t Safe—Trust the Experts Instead

It’s tempting to tackle minor electrical issues yourself, especially after watching a few videos online. However, without proper tools and training, even small mistakes can cause injuries or damage. For example, wiring a switch incorrectly could shock you or spark a fire.

Quick-response local-electricians in town are trained to work with high voltage safely. Therefore, you stay out of harm’s way while they handle everything with skill. Moreover, their work usually comes with warranties, licensing, and code compliance guarantees—which means you’re also protected long-term.

FAQ: Getting the Help You Need from Quick-Response Local-Electricians in Town

  • Q: How fast can an emergency electrician arrive?
    A: Many local electricians can be at your door in 30 to 60 minutes, depending on location and time of day.
  • Q: Will I pay more for a quick response?
    A: Urgent calls may carry higher fees, especially after hours—but many local providers offer flat or transparent pricing.
  • Q: Are quick-response services covered by homeowners insurance?
    A: Some emergency repairs may be covered, especially if tied to fire risk or storm damage. Check with your agent.
  • Q: Can emergency electricians handle commercial issues too?
    A: Yes. Most are trained and licensed for both residential and commercial systems. Just confirm ahead of time.
